body {
	background-image: url(images/fond.jpg);
	background-repeat: repeat-x;
	background-color: #009102;
	margin:0;
}
.bg {
	background-image: url(images/bg.gif);
}
.txt {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#003300;
}
.txt a:link:hover{color: #336633;}
.txtjaune {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#e5c10a;
}
.txtjaune: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#e5c10a;
}
.txtjaune: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#f5f490;
}
.calendcont{
background-position:550px 0px;
background-repeat:no-repeat;
background-image:url(images/velosjaune.jpg);
background-color:#FFFFE8;
height:160px;
border: inset 1px #dec406;
}
.calendentet{
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ight:bold;
color: #064406;
border: ridge 1px #f5f490;
background-image:url(images/fondentete.gif);
heigth:10px;}
.vigncont{
background-color:#FFFFE8;
height:140px;
width:140px;
border: inset 1px #dec406;}
.vignentet{
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ight:bold;
color: #064406;
border: ridge 1px #f5f490;
background-color:#40e26a;
background-image:url(images/fondentete.gif);
background-repeat:repeat-x;
heigth:10px;
width:140}
.detailtitre{font-family: Arial, Helvetica, sans-serif;
font-size: 24px;
font-weight:bold;
color: #064406;
border-bottom: ridge 1px #f5f490;
}
.ref{font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ight:bold;
color: #064406;
border-bottom: ridge 1px #f5f490;
}
.gh
{ float : left; margin-bottom:7px; margin-right:12px;margin-top:23px; }
.gh2
{ float : left; margin-bottom:7px; margin-right:12px; border: inset 2px #00BD19;}
.promo{
position:absolute;
z-index:10;
font-family: Arial, Helvetica, sans-serif;
font-size: 10px;
border: ridge 1px #f5f490;
font-weight:lighter;
background-color:#F5f490;
color: #064406;

}
.tab{
	background-position:550px 0px;
	background-repeat:no-repeat;
	background-image:url(images/velosjaune.jpg);
	background-color:#FFFFE8;
	height:160px;
	border: inset 1px #00BD19;
}
.titreplan {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-style: normal;
	color: #5F0666;
	font-weight: bold;
}
.txtplan {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	color: #333333;
}
.plan {
	width: 400px;
	height: 330px;
	border: inset 1px #00BD19;
}